Installing the gateway software

Before installing your gateway software, you should make a backup copy of
the installation disks, the Apple IP Gateway Installer 1 and Apple IP Gateway
Installer 2,
which you will find in the Apple IP Gateway package. Put the
originals aside for safekeeping, and use the backups for installation.

This section describes the Easy Install procedure that Apple recommends as
well as the Custom Install procedure that you may want to use instead. The
section also shows you how to specify locations for software installation if you
don’t want to use the default locations for which the Installer is set.

Using Easy Install

Easy Install places all the software Apple recommends in the appropriate
locations on your startup disk. This includes

m the Gateway Manager
m the MacTCP control panel
m all necessary system extensions
m SNMP network-management software
m AppleTalk version 58.1.3 (for United States users)
Note: International users can use Easy Install. All software installed with the
Network Software Installer will be retained.

To install this software:

1

Insert the backup copy of the

Apple IP Gateway Installer 1 disk into your computer’s

floppy disk drive and double-click the Apple IP Gateway icon to open it.

The Installer icon is in the window that appears.
